Go语言系统编程
信号处理
knative
knative项目提供了信号处理的封装。
等待信号
1 2 3 4 5 6 7 8 9 10 |
import "github.com/knative/pkg/signals" // 创建默认的信号处理器 stopCh := signals.SetupSignalHandler() // goroutine应该等待此通道可读,然后清理并退出 go func(stopCh <-chan struct{}){ <-stopCh }(stopCh) |
← Sass学习笔记
Leave a Reply